Ticket #— Floor 9 Opening Prep, Brindlemoor House

Hi facilities folks, Floor 9 opens to staff next Monday and we need a few things squared away before then. Lift access is live, but the two side doors by the kitchenette are still on the old lock config — please reprogram them before Friday. Also, signage for the quiet rooms hasn't arrived, so pop up the temporary printed ones for now. Until the badge readers sync, the interim door code for Floor 9 is below.

door code, bajop-bajog: bdg-DSWAC-43621

## 2024-05-18 — Key rotation for StockTally recon job

Heads up: we rotated the deploy key used by the StockTally inventory reconciliation job after it popped up in last month's access review. Old key is revoked, cron entries on the Harbrook workers updated, and the nightly run completed clean twice since. Nothing else touches this key, so blast radius is tiny. The new key is pasted below for your review.

signing key of bagap-yawep = bky13_TbfT6ZMUoGJo2

**Release checklist — Lanternbridge Gateway rollout**

- [ ] Verify that every instance behind the Corvid load balancer returns a healthy status on the readiness endpoint before shifting traffic. Do not rely on the liveness probe alone; it ignores dependency state. Confirm the drain timeout is set to 45 seconds, then record which build you validated using the trace token below.

pipeline stamp: htk9_6ce9d33c5